What is HeyVite?
HeyVite is a digital invitation and RSVP platform. You create an invitation, add your guests, and send it by email, or share each guest’s personal invitation link through WhatsApp, text, or another app. Then every reply, meal choice and plus-one tracks itself on one live dashboard. It is free to start, and your guest list is hidden from other guests by default.
How does HeyVite work?
Three steps: choose a design and make it yours, add your guests and send. HeyVite emails each guest their personal invitation link, or you can copy links and share them yourself. Then watch RSVPs, meals and plus-ones arrive on your live dashboard. Send a reminder now or schedule one for later, and only guests who haven't replied get it, so the follow-up takes one step instead of a list of messages.
How do I create my first event?
Choose “Create an invitation,” add your event details, and pick a design. Personalize the invitation, then add your guests and choose how to send it. Creating the event does not send invitations.
What kinds of events can I use HeyVite for?
Any celebration. HeyVite works for weddings, birthdays, baby and bridal showers, graduations, anniversaries, corporate events, parties and more. You can browse designs by occasion on the invitations page.
Does HeyVite work on my phone?
Yes. HeyVite works in any mobile browser. There is nothing to download. Hosts can create, send and track from their phone, and guests can open their invitation and RSVP from theirs.
What makes HeyVite different from other invitation platforms?
Privacy by design. Give each guest a personal invitation link and collect their reply in one place. By default, guests cannot browse your guest list or search for another person’s invitation. Guest Privacy is included on every plan, free ones too, and it is the default on every event. If you want one open, share-anywhere link instead, name search is yours to turn on for a single event. That is paired with designer cards and live RSVP tracking.

Pricing & plans

Is HeyVite free to use?
Yes. The Free plan is genuinely free. You can design and send invitations and track RSVPs without paying anything, and no credit card is needed to sign up. Every design and feature is included on every plan; the only thing a paid plan buys is a larger guest list for a single event.
How much does HeyVite cost?
HeyVite is free to start. Paid plans are $15, $45 or $110, each a single payment for a single event. Planning an event with more than 900 guests? Contact us about a larger guest list. The full comparison is on the pricing page.
Is HeyVite a subscription?
No. Paid plans are a single payment for a single event: $15, $45 or $110 depending on the plan. There is no recurring charge and nothing to cancel.
What is the difference between the plans?
Every plan includes the same designs and features: the full Card Studio, the premium and luxe designs, the envelope reveal, the wedding website, Guest Privacy, and a watermark-free card. The only difference between plans is how many guests you can invite: free up to 75, then $15 for up to 150 guests, $45 for up to 300 and $110 for up to 900. The side-by-side comparison lives on the pricing page.
Do I need a credit card to start?
No. The Free plan asks for no credit card and no payment details. You only add payment if you choose to upgrade a specific event to a paid plan.
Will guests see ads on my invitation?
No. HeyVite never shows ads on your invitation, on any plan, and there is no watermark on any plan either. Every event gets the same clean, ad-free experience whether it is free or paid.
What is your refund policy?
You can request a full refund within 14 days of payment if you have not sent any invitations. Email [email protected] for help, or read the full policy at heyvite.com/refund-policy.

Sending & delivery

How do I send invitations to my guests?
Send invitations by email through HeyVite, or copy each guest’s personal link and share it through WhatsApp, text, or another messaging app. Either way, each guest opens their own personal invitation link to view the invitation and RSVP.
Do guests need an app or account to open an invitation?
No. Guests open their invitation in any browser from the link you send: nothing to download, no account to create, no password. They can read it and RSVP in seconds from a phone.
Can I send a save-the-date first?
Yes. Send a save-the-date first and follow up with the full invitation later, all from the same event. Your guest list carries over, so you only build it once.
Can I edit my invitation after sending it?
Yes. Update the event details and guests will see the latest version when they reopen their invitation. For an important change, send a separate update so guests know to check.
How many guests can I invite?
Each event is free for up to 75 named guests. Paid plans increase that limit for one event. Partners, children, and named plus-ones count toward the total. Compare guest limits on the pricing page.
A guest did not receive their invitation. What should I do?
Check the email address on their guest record and ask them to check their spam or junk folder. Correct the address if needed, then resend the invitation. You can also copy their personal link and send it through a messaging app.

RSVPs & tracking

How do guests RSVP?
Guests RSVP straight from the private link you sent them, no account needed. Their reply, meal choice, plus-ones and head count land on your dashboard the moment they respond.
Can guests change their RSVP after replying?
Yes. Guests can update their RSVP anytime by reopening their private link, and your dashboard reflects the change instantly, so your head count is always current.
How do I track RSVPs, meals and plus-ones?
Everything lands on one live dashboard. Every RSVP, meal choice, dietary note, plus-one and head count updates in real time, so when the caterer or venue asks for numbers, a glance gives you the answer.
Does HeyVite send RSVP reminders automatically?
You can send a reminder immediately or schedule one for later. When a scheduled reminder sends, HeyVite checks who still has not replied and emails those guests.
Can I export my guest list and responses?
Yes. You can export your guest list and responses from the dashboard (to a spreadsheet for the caterer or venue, for example), so your data is always yours.
Should I delete my guest list and upload it again to fix a problem?
Almost never, and it is worth knowing why before you do. Removing a guest also removes their reply, meal choice, dietary notes and anything they signed up to bring, and the invitation link already sitting in their inbox stops working. Editing a guest instead keeps every one of those things. If something looks wrong on your list, open that guest and change the details directly.
What happens if I remove a guest by mistake?
Removing a guest cannot be undone, and re-adding them does not bring their reply back. They return as a new guest with no RSVP, and they need a fresh invitation link because the old one no longer works. If you only need to correct a name, an email or a phone number, edit the guest instead and nothing else changes.
Can I change a guest's name or email without resending their invitation?
Yes. Editing an existing guest keeps their invitation link and RSVP connected to their record, so a corrected spelling does not disturb anything they have already done. If you correct their email address, resend the invitation to that address.
Does resending an invitation cost anything?
No. Sending again to people who are already on your guest list, whether that is a reminder or a corrected invitation, does not count against your plan. Your plan covers the size of your guest list, not how many times you contact them.

Guest privacy

Can guests see who else is invited?
By default, guests cannot browse your guest list or search for another person’s invitation. Each guest uses a personal link to view their invitation and reply. If you enable name search, people with your event’s shared link can look up invitations by name; it is off by default.
Does every guest get their own link?
Yes, on every plan. Each guest receives a unique link to their own invitation, addressed to them, where they RSVP and see only their own reply.
Can I forward an invitation link?
A personal invitation link belongs to the guest it was created for. Forwarding it can give someone else access to that guest’s invitation and RSVP. To invite another person, add them to your guest list and send their own link.
What exactly is Guest Privacy?
Guest Privacy is how HeyVite protects your guest list. It is included on every plan, free ones too, and it is the default on every new event: no public guest list, no name lookup, and per-guest isolation, so each guest sees only their own invitation and their own reply, and only you, the host, see the full roster. The one exception is yours to make. If you would rather share one open link anywhere, you can deliberately open that single event to a share-anywhere link with name search, and a visitor holding the link can then look a guest up by name. It stays off unless you turn it on, event by event.
Is my data safe with HeyVite?
Yes. Your details and your guests' details stay private to you. We never sell your data. You can also protect your own account with a passkey and two-factor authentication.

Designs & Card Studio

Can I customize the invitation designs?
Yes. Every template opens in the Card Studio, where you edit the wording, colors and details until the card feels like yours. Browse the full collection by occasion on the invitations page.
Can I upload my own artwork?
Yes. Bring a finished design (from a designer, another tool, anywhere), and HeyVite will make it the whole card, so your invitation looks exactly the way you created it, with private links and RSVP tracking still built in.

Planning tools

Can one event have multiple parts, like a ceremony and reception?
Yes. Group several moments (say a ceremony, dinner and after-party) under one event, invite the right guests to each part, and collect a separate reply for every one.
Can guests vote on a date before I pick one?
Yes. Run a date poll and let guests vote on the dates that work for them; once a winner is clear, lock it in and send the invitation.
Can I create a wedding website?
Yes, on every plan, free ones too. Build a wedding website alongside your invitation to share your story, schedule, travel and accommodation details, and more: one place your guests can return to all the way through the big day.
Can I share photos with guests after the event?
Yes. Events can include a shared photo album where you and your guests upload pictures and relive the celebration together afterward.

Account, security & support

How do I sign in to HeyVite?
Use "Log In" at the top right. You can sign in with a passkey (nothing to remember) or with a password; both are supported.
How do I secure my account?
Turn on a passkey and two-factor authentication (2FA) under Settings → Security. A passkey is the strongest option: it is phishing-resistant and there is no password to steal.
I'm a guest and I can't find my invitation link. What do I do?
Look for the message from your host in your email or messages. Your invitation is a personal link addressed to you. If you cannot find it, ask your host to resend your personal invitation link.
